OYO DIOCESE HOLDS ANNUAL MARIAN PILGRIMAGE

Thousands of people flocked the town of Tede for annual spiritual pilgrimage to the Oke Maria Pilgrimage and Retreat Centre, Tede in ATISBO Local Government of Oyo State. This year’s pilgrimage with the theme ‘nothing is impossible for God’ came up on Friday 7th and Saturday 8th December, 2018 with both Catholics and non-Catholics coming together to pray through the intercession of the Blessed Virgin Mary to God who made all things possible for his people.
The Bible Service on Friday 7th at St Mary Magdalene Catholic Church, Tede started by 3pm with Fr Jerome Ogunleye as the preacher while the same Bible Service was being held concurrently on the Marian Hill for the aged and the sick. The Bible Service was followed by the joyful praise-filled procession of the pilgrims to the Pilgrimage Centre. The procession ended around 8pm with the prayer led by the Bishop of the Catholic Diocese of Oyo – Most Rev Emmanuel Badejo at the Grotto on the Marian Hill.
The programme continued throughout the night with different segments anchored by different priests. It featured Adoration of the Blessed Sacrament, Stations of the Cross, Sacrament of Reconciliation, Healing and Anointing, Divine Mercy, thanksgiving of praise and worship and many others before finally ending with the Holy Mass early morning of Saturday 8th December, 2018.
In his homily, Rev. Fr Francis Olufunmilayo the parish priest of Divine Mercy Catholic Church Saki, enjoined the people to always be like Mary who became what God wanted her to be and not what she wanted to be because a lot of problem we are encountering nowadays is because people are no longer what God wants them to be but what they want to be since they no longer let the will of God be done in their lives.
